Transaction c16e40b4718c21098ad281707774ab4530275fb83c62bd33f67879f417a21fae

1 Input
2 Outputs
  • c16e40b4718c21098ad281707774ab4530275fb83c62bd33f67879f417a21fae:0
  • value  37374549
    address  3JujonW5ecGDZ3aTc5PkvRmqosZNCUrVKF
  • c16e40b4718c21098ad281707774ab4530275fb83c62bd33f67879f417a21fae:1
  • value  2529688
    address  38oinRN2CzJGD6gxENv3AtvcZD986rSEE5